If you are a homeowner of age 62 or older, with considerable equity in your home you may be eligible to participate in the FHA Home Equity Conversion.

The FHA reverse mortgage loan is also known as a Home Equity Conversion Mortgage (HECM), and is paid back when the homeowner no longer occupies the property. A HECM, or Home Equity Conversion Mortgage, is the technical term for the federally-insured reverse mortgage. Therefore a HECM to HECM refinance (also known as a H2H Refi), occurs when the borrower is paying off an existing HECM with a new HECM.

Reverse Mortgage Costs Aarp Typically, mortgage insurance premiums, origination fees and other closing costs are financed into the loan – as much as $10,000 or more on a loan of $138,000. The amount you can borrow depends on your age, your home’s value and interest rates.

A Home Equity Conversion Mortgage (HECM) for Purchase is a reverse mortgage that allows seniors, age 62 or older, to purchase a new principal residence using loan proceeds from the reverse mortgage.
